Whispers of the Forbidden Forest

In the heart of the Wounded World, where the land is scarred by age-old conflicts and the skies are perpetually shrouded in a gray mist, there lay a forest known only in legends—the Forbidden Forest. It was said that within its depths, the ancient prophecies of the world were woven into the very essence of its trees, and those who dared to enter its embrace would either find enlightenment or be swallowed by the dark forces that lurked there.

Amara, a young healer of the Order of the Light, had heard the tales of the Forbidden Forest since childhood. Her mother had whispered of it, her voice tinged with a mix of awe and fear, "One day, you will go there, Amara. You will seek the Heart of the Forest, and in doing so, you will uncover the truth that binds our world."

Amara's life was simple, yet filled with purpose. She studied the ancient texts of healing, mastering the delicate balance of herbs and incantations that could mend a broken bone or ease the pain of the heart. But as she grew older, the whispers of the Forbidden Forest grew louder, and the call to seek its Heart became an insistent drumbeat in her mind.

One day, as she tended to the sick in her village, a strange man approached her. His eyes were deep and weary, and his voice was a low rumble, "Amara, the time has come. You must leave this place and seek the Heart of the Forbidden Forest."

Confused, Amara asked, "Who are you, and why do you know my name?"

The man's eyes glinted with a hint of mischief. "I am known as the Seeker. I have been chosen to guide you on this journey. But be warned, Amara, for the path is fraught with danger, and those who seek the Heart of the Forest do not always return."

Despite her doubts, Amara knew the time had come. She gathered her meager belongings and set out on the long journey to the Forbidden Forest. Along the way, she encountered many who had heard the call, each with their own tale of trials and triumphs. Some had found the Heart, others had perished in the dark woods.

As Amara ventured deeper into the forest, she found herself in a realm where the rules of her world no longer applied. The trees were ancient and wise, their leaves shimmering with a hint of magic. She felt the pull of the Heart, drawing her ever closer.

But as she reached the heart of the forest, she discovered that the Heart was not a physical object, but a series of trials that would test her resolve and her heart. The first trial was a mirror, reflecting her fears and doubts. With each reflection, she had to choose between her fears and her destiny.

The next trial was a whispering wind, carrying the voices of those who had failed. It was a test of her patience and her ability to listen to the true voice within her.

The final trial was a confrontation with the Betrayer, a once-trusted mentor who had been corrupted by the dark forces of the forest. The Betrayer sought to turn her away from the Heart, to keep her in the world of shadows.

"You are too weak, Amara," the Betrayer hissed. "You do not have the strength to face the Heart of the Forest."

Amara stood firm, her eyes blazing with determination. "I have faced my fears, and I have listened to my heart. I am ready to face the Heart."

With a swift and decisive strike, Amara banished the Betrayer, and the Heart of the Forest revealed itself to her—a glowing orb of light that pulsed with the life force of the Wounded World.

As she held the Heart, she felt a surge of power course through her veins. The prophecies of the forest unfolded before her eyes, and she understood that her journey was not just for herself, but for the entire world.

With the Heart in her possession, Amara returned to her village, her heart full of newfound purpose. She knew that the Wounded World was in dire need of healing, and she was ready to face whatever challenges lay ahead.

And so, the journey of the Wishful Healer in the Wounded World continued, her heart filled with hope and her mind unwavering in her quest to heal the world.
